Title XXXIII EVIDENCE AND LEGAL ADVERTISEMENTS Chapter 492 • Effective - 28 Aug 1939 492.360. Exhibits to be enclosed with depositions and directed to clerk. — Depositions or examinations taken by virtue of any of the provisions of sections 492.080 to 492.400 and all exhibits produced to the person or officer taking such examinations or depositions, and proved or referred to by any witness, together with the commission and interrogatories, if any, shall be enclosed, sealed up, and directed to the clerk of the court in which or the associate circuit judge before whom the action is pending. ­­-------- (RSMo 1939 § 1943) Prior revisions: 1929 § 1779; 1919 § 5466; 1909 § 6410
